EPICS Controls Argonne National Laboratory

Experimental Physics and
Industrial Control System

1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  <2025 Index 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  <2025
<== Date ==> <== Thread ==>

Subject: RE: EPICS Clients in C++ [SEC=OFFICIAL]
From: "STARRITT, Andrew via Tech-talk" <tech-talk at aps.anl.gov>
To: Abdalla Ahmad <Abdalla.Ahmad at sesame.org.jo>, Ralph Lange <ralph.lange at gmx.de>
Cc: "tech-talk at aps.anl.gov" <Tech-talk at aps.anl.gov>
Date: Fri, 27 Jun 2025 00:57:42 +0000

Hi Abdalla,
Take a look at the ACAI library used by EPICS Qt for CA.   It has a C++ API, although prob not very modern.
It is on github here:  https://github.com/andrewstarritt/acai.git
Cheers
Andrew

OFFICIAL

From: Tech-talk <tech-talk-bounces at aps.anl.gov> On Behalf Of Abdalla Ahmad via Tech-talk
Sent: Tuesday, 24 June 2025 3:42 PM
To: Ralph Lange <ralph.lange at gmx.de>
Cc: tech-talk at aps.anl.gov
Subject: RE: EPICS Clients in C++

 

CAUTION, EXTERNAL EMAIL: This message has come from outside of ANSTO. Do not take action, click links or open attachments unless you trust the source of this message and know the content is safe. Report spam and phishing using the Report Message button or if unsure, forward this message to servicedesk at ansto.gov.au as an attachment.

 

Thanks Ralph. Is there something similar for channel access? In other words, a C++ implementation of channel access?

 

Best Regards,

Abdalla Al-Dalleh

Control Engineer

SESAME

P.O. Box 7, Allan 19252, Jordan
Tel: +96253511348 , ext. 265

Fax: +96253511423

Email : abdalla.ahmad at sesame.org.jo
Website: www.sesame.org.jo

 

From: Tech-talk <tech-talk-bounces at aps.anl.gov> On Behalf Of Ralph Lange via Tech-talk
Sent: Sunday, June 22, 2025 4:15 PM
To: EPICS Tech Talk <tech-talk at aps.anl.gov>
Subject: Re: EPICS Clients in C++

 

On Sun, 22 Jun 2025 at 10:57, Abdalla Ahmad via Tech-talk <tech-talk at aps.anl.gov> wrote:

 

Is there a client API for EPICS implemented in C++ not just a wrapper for the C API? Possibly using recent C++ standards?

 

PVXS.

 

Cheers,
~Ralph


References:
EPICS Clients in C++ Abdalla Ahmad via Tech-talk
Re: EPICS Clients in C++ Ralph Lange via Tech-talk
RE: EPICS Clients in C++ Abdalla Ahmad via Tech-talk

Navigate by Date:
Prev: Generation of state diagram documentation from SNL Ed Janke via Tech-talk
Next: Re: Generation of state diagram documentation from SNL Jure Varlec via Tech-talk
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  <2025
Navigate by Thread:
Prev: Re: EPICS Clients in C++ Johnson, Andrew N. via Tech-talk
Next: Re: Some questions about CaLab (Dariush Hampai) Carsten Winkler via Tech-talk
Index: 1994  1995  1996  1997  1998  1999  2000  2001  2002  2003  2004  2005  2006  2007  2008  2009  2010  2011  2012  2013  2014  2015  2016  2017  2018  2019  2020  2021  2022  2023  2024  <2025
ANJ, 27 Jun 2025 Valid HTML 4.01! · Home · News · About · Base · Modules · Extensions · Distributions ·
· Download · Search · IRMIS · Talk · Documents · Links · Licensing ·